DIRECTOR OF PUBLIC WORKS PHONE 574/235-9251 FAx 574/235-9171 TDD 574/ 235-5567 Subject: Proposed Appropriation of $ 1 million Major Moves funds from Fund 202 for Douglas Road Improvements Dear Council President Rouse: This is in follow-up to the presentation I made at your last Council meeting committee session on this topic (copy attached). We are ready to appropriate funds to move this economic development project to fruition. The City of South Bend is excited to be partnering with Douglas Road Retail Partners, L.P. (Holladay Properties), hereinafter "Holladay" on improvements along the Douglas Road gateway to South Bend. The City, in partnership with Holladay, has designed (through Abonmarche Consultants) and bid plans for improvements to Douglas Road from SR 23 to the Mishawaka City limits (lowest responsible responsive bidder is Brooks Construction). Holladay has worked with us to expedite design and right of way acquisition and provisions for stormwater so that this two lane road can be transformed to two travel lanes in each direction plus center turn lane as needed and two dedicated left turn lanes at SR23 and Douglas. The overall project is $ 2 million with a plan to repay infrastructure loans from the Douglas TIF economic development area taxes. The TIF is anchored by the existing Memorial Home Care building. Holladay is the owner of that $ 4.75 million development with Memorial as the long term tenant of the building and the taxpayer. Holladay has further agreed to construct additional projects in the TIF valued at $ 3.3 million. The taxes will be sufficient to repay the $ 1 million Major Moves loan at 5 % and the $ 1.1 million ($ 100,000 as contingency for transaction expenses if needed) private loan at 5 % through Wells Fargo guaranteed by Holladay. The taxes on the economic development projects in this TIF will repay the loan sources plus interest to enable the infrastructure to be built sooner rather than later. The early action is important to public safety and as a catalyst for this area to develop the way we would all like to see it. The two lane road is in bad shape and has a lack of proper drainage.
